#include <bits/stdc++.h>
using namespace std;
const int maxn = 1050 ;
int n , m , c , temp ;
int arr[maxn] ;
int main(){
int num = 0 ;
scanf("%d %d %d" , &n , &m , &c) ;
memset(arr , -1 , sizeof(arr)) ;
while(m --){
scanf("%d" , &temp) ;
if(temp > c / 2){
for(int i = n ; i >= 1 ; i --){
if(arr[i] == -1 || arr[i] < temp){
if(arr[i] == -1) num ++ ;
arr[i] = temp ;
printf("%d\n" , i) ;
fflush(stdout) ;
break ;
}
}
}else{
for(int i = 1 ; i <= n ; i ++ ){
if(arr[i] == -1 || arr[i] > temp){
if(arr[i] == -1) num ++ ;
arr[i] = temp ;
printf("%d\n" , i) ;
fflush(stdout) ;
break ;
}
}
}
if(num == n) return 0 ;
}
return 0 ;
}
CodeForce896 B. Ithea Plays With Chtholly
最新推荐文章于 2022-05-22 00:06:39 发布